A fish you don't see too often!

These beasts are Red wolf fish, scientifically known as (Erythrinus erythrinus) and these are the Peruvian locality.

A predatory fish that is compatible with large cichlids, barbs and catfish.

I (John) had a few days off over the past weekend (how dare i) to visit two close friends and their family.

We'd sourced a group of rare cichlids for Si, a species that is hard to find and an absolute gem. As it happened , it timed perfectly with our visit. Myself and my wife were at the shop at 7.30am on a Friday morning catching them and we delivered them ourselves.

The main fish Si was searching for was Heros severus, which used to be known as Heros sp. Curare.

There was much debate for years to define which species is the actual, "Real" H.severus and the species properly entered the hobby around a decade or so ago. Early offered adult pairs sold for £350, which I know from personal, expensive experience 😅

Between myself, my dad Darren Southall and Si Dawson we kept this amazing fish for a few years, collecting a total of 10 specimens of varying sizes in the end.

We also had to barely convince Si to buy a few other South American beauties, an as-of-yet unidentified dwarf pike cichlid and a very impressive L027, Gold-line panaque (Panaque ambrusteri).

Si has supported the shop for years and continues to do so, all the way down in Plymouth!!

Most of the fish photographed have been supplied by us to contribute to his jaw-droping selection of fish.

I'm pretty sure we'll be supplying more fish to Si in the future, and we're incredibly appreciative of the support from 3.5hrs away!
